06-02-2012 11:07 PM #5
Is the BMW still under factory warranty? if so then get it. It wont be a big pain if you take good care of it. And besides if something happens before the warranty goes out then BMW will fix it at no charge. And BMW will cover normal, scheduled part replacements for you during the warranty. For example, they want the belt replaced every 30k miles, BMW will cover that no matter if the belt is bad or not.
